Job summary

ICI Services Corporation seeks a Naval Architect III to join our Washington, DC team. The role focuses on engineering support across lifecycle acquisition for UxV platforms, translating requirements into design, and supporting reviews and TRL assessments.

The ideal candidate will have 4–7 years in Naval Architecture, DoD procedures experience, and some supervisory exposure. Bachelor’s in engineering or naval architecture is required.

Qualifications

  • 4 to 7 years of professional experience in Naval Architecture.
  • Experience with DoD/DoN procedures and policies (DoD 5000 process).
  • Supervisory experience; experience communicating with SES/Flag level personnel; ship building experience desired.

Responsibilities

  • Provide engineering and technical support across lifecycle acquisition from early development through fielding.
  • Perform analyses of mission and performance requirements for UxV platforms and translate into design direction, performance, configuration, space and weight, and arrangements.
  • Assist in evaluations and recommendations regarding TRL of overall proposals and integrated systems.
